黑狐家游戏

大数据平台数据采集架构是什么样的,大数据平台数据采集架构是什么,揭秘大数据平台数据采集架构,高效处理海量数据的秘密武器

欧气 0 0
大数据平台数据采集架构主要涵盖数据源接入、数据预处理、数据存储与索引等环节。通过高效的数据采集,实现海量数据的实时采集与处理。该架构以高效处理海量数据为核心,是大数据平台的秘密武器。

本文目录导读:

  1. 大数据平台数据采集架构概述
  2. 大数据平台数据采集架构的关键要素
  3. 大数据平台数据采集架构的优势

在大数据时代,数据采集作为大数据平台的核心环节,扮演着至关重要的角色,一个高效、稳定的数据采集架构,能够为后续的数据处理、分析和应用提供源源不断的优质数据资源,本文将深入剖析大数据平台数据采集架构,揭示其高效处理海量数据的秘密武器。

大数据平台数据采集架构概述

大数据平台数据采集架构是指在大数据环境中,将各种类型的数据从不同的源头采集、传输、存储和预处理,为后续的数据处理和分析提供数据支撑的总体架构,其核心目标在于实现数据的高效采集、统一存储和智能处理。

大数据平台数据采集架构的关键要素

1、数据源

大数据平台数据采集架构是什么样的,大数据平台数据采集架构是什么,揭秘大数据平台数据采集架构,高效处理海量数据的秘密武器

图片来源于网络,如有侵权联系删除

数据源是数据采集架构的基础,包括内部系统和外部系统,内部系统主要指企业内部的各种业务系统,如ERP、CRM等;外部系统则包括互联网、社交媒体、物联网设备等,数据源的类型、规模和复杂性决定了数据采集架构的设计。

2、数据采集技术

数据采集技术是实现数据采集的关键,主要包括以下几种:

(1)ETL(Extract-Transform-Load):ETL技术是一种数据抽取、转换和加载的过程,用于从数据源中提取数据,进行转换后加载到目标系统中。

(2)数据抓取:针对网页、API接口等非结构化数据源,通过爬虫、爬虫框架等技术进行数据抓取。

(3)日志采集:通过采集系统日志、网络日志等,获取系统运行过程中的数据。

(4)物联网设备采集:针对物联网设备,通过设备协议、API接口等技术进行数据采集。

3、数据传输

数据传输是数据采集架构中的重要环节,主要包括以下几种:

(1)数据流:利用消息队列、流处理技术实现数据的高效传输。

大数据平台数据采集架构是什么样的,大数据平台数据采集架构是什么,揭秘大数据平台数据采集架构,高效处理海量数据的秘密武器

图片来源于网络,如有侵权联系删除

(2)文件传输:通过FTP、HTTP等协议进行文件传输。

(3)数据同步:利用数据库同步、数据复制等技术实现数据同步。

4、数据存储

数据存储是数据采集架构的基石,主要包括以下几种:

(1)关系型数据库:适用于结构化数据存储,如MySQL、Oracle等。

(2)非关系型数据库:适用于非结构化数据存储,如MongoDB、Cassandra等。

(3)分布式文件系统:适用于海量数据存储,如Hadoop HDFS、Alluxio等。

5、数据预处理

数据预处理是数据采集架构的重要环节,主要包括以下几种:

(1)数据清洗:去除数据中的噪声、错误和冗余信息。

大数据平台数据采集架构是什么样的,大数据平台数据采集架构是什么,揭秘大数据平台数据采集架构,高效处理海量数据的秘密武器

图片来源于网络,如有侵权联系删除

(2)数据转换:将不同数据源的数据格式进行统一。

(3)数据集成:将来自不同数据源的数据进行整合。

大数据平台数据采集架构的优势

1、高效性:通过采用高效的数据采集技术,实现海量数据的快速采集和处理。

2、可扩展性:数据采集架构可根据业务需求进行灵活扩展,满足不同规模的数据采集需求。

3、灵活性:支持多种数据源、多种数据采集技术和多种数据存储方式,满足不同场景的数据采集需求。

4、可靠性:采用多种数据传输和存储技术,确保数据采集过程的稳定性和可靠性。

5、智能化:通过引入人工智能、机器学习等技术,实现数据采集的智能化,提高数据采集效率和质量。

大数据平台数据采集架构是实现高效处理海量数据的秘密武器,通过对数据源、数据采集技术、数据传输、数据存储和数据预处理等关键要素的深入剖析,我们可以更好地理解其优势和应用场景,在未来的大数据时代,掌握数据采集架构的设计与优化,将为企业和个人带来巨大的价值。

标签: #大数据采集架构 #高效数据处理 #架构揭秘

黑狐家游戏
  • 评论列表

留言评论